Google Market Overview

According to in-store data from Grips Intelligence, Google generated an average product price of $163.87 across four major retailers — Amazon, Best Buy, Lowe's, and Newegg — during the January to May 2026 period. Amazon dominated Google's retail distribution, commanding an overwhelming 89.5% share of total revenue, far outpacing Best Buy at 5.6% and Lowe's at 3.0%. Despite this strong retail concentration, Google's overall revenue declined 4.7% over the tracked period, signaling potential headwinds in consumer demand. Average pricing also saw a slight dip of 0.9% overall, though the most recent month recorded a 4.8% price increase, suggesting a possible stabilization or upward pricing shift. These trends indicate that while Google maintains a highly centralized retail strategy anchored by Amazon, the brand faces near-term revenue pressure across its product portfolio.

Google's online vs offline revenue split

BY REVENUE

Google sells 90% online and 10% offline. Online runs through 3 channels; offline through 2. Online share has moved from 22% in Jan to 92% in May.

Google's customer ratings

BY REVIEW COUNT

Across 3.02M ratings on 4 channels, Google averages 4.3. Most reviews for the products are in the 4.2–4.4 range.
